‹ E-CIPM 26-292: AGNES, WHO WAS THE WIFE OF JOHN DYKMAN SENIOR ›
AGNES, WHO WAS THE WIFE OF JOHN DYKMAN SENIOR
Inquisition Head
WILTSHIRE. Inquisition [indented]. Wilton. 2 November 1445. [Restwold].
Jurors
Jurors: John Rous ; John Lambert ; John Turpyn ; John Kyngeswode ; John Seward ; John Blyk ; John Porter ; Thomas Everard ; William Palet ; Robert Pystor ; William Upton ; and Robert Parys .
Holdings
She was seised of the following in demesne as of fee.She died on 2 February 1433. Maud, wife of John Coupere , is her kin and next heir, as the daughter of Thomas, the son of Agnes, and is aged 19 and more.
John Dykman, junior , received the issues of the messuage, etc., in Wishford, from her death until the taking of this inquisition. John Mayn received the issues of the messuage, etc., in Stoford and South Newton for the same period, how and by what title the jurors do not know.
[Head:] Delivered to court on 20 November 1445.
TNA reference
C 139/118/16 mm. 1–2
